Roman,
See attached pics. The switch is a 3 way with a center off position. It’s the one on the bottom of the handlebar strapped to the top one (spotlight).
I’ve located the flasher inside the fork tins. Also, find a picture with the correct pilot lenses, brackets and spacer required for correct installation. Feel free to PM me with additional questions.

Mine is a 58 too, but police model, so on the right side of the handlebar I have the speedo hand lock switch.
When I got it, only spotlights were installed but wires were cut and the spotlight switch was on the right handlebar
close to the handlock switch.
There was a toggle switch on the fork right tin panel (both spotlights had also their own toggle switch) but the wires were also cut.
There was a flasher bolted to the left tin panel with also cut wires.
I think the flasher was for a police use of the spotlights, but do you know what was the use of the toggle switch as there was already a spotlights
switch on the handlebar ?

I have installed directional lights and I have to install the switch now. Do I put it on the right side of the handlebar with the spotligth switch
and the handlock switch or is there another solution on police bikes ?
